Output 24f4627228acd9c8a00a8bbf24fdb77509ad5c353faede13c4184fb889e801df:1

value
1677574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bbee7ba0edc48062f29ce0b19c9108da670482d OP_EQUAL
address
3Mivbsx4dcvZfEgWps2byXFS2niKNxGAF6
transaction
24f4627228acd9c8a00a8bbf24fdb77509ad5c353faede13c4184fb889e801df
confirmations
278807
spent
true